Output 357929cdff0e5dfde9a16765c0ab72c90f2750c39c41c20d3bcdfd084793e339:0

value
27039291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 484eeabed408d845ba28b511a2269c6c98421fd5 OP_EQUAL
address
MEVVRVLsGEpDqe4fMy5MU7yngQgiTEWs8e
transaction
357929cdff0e5dfde9a16765c0ab72c90f2750c39c41c20d3bcdfd084793e339
spent
true